Branxton Community Walkers
Braxton Community Walkers are new members of Heart Foundation Walking. The group commenced walking in March 2011in the Upper Hunter. The group may be small but their motivation has them walking three times a week regardless of rain, wind or cold weather. Thanks to the group’s enthusiasm and support, walking is a pleasure not a chore. Some members of the group have added a whole new dimension to walking and are using hiking poles. The poles reduce the impact on the lower body while also assisting with balance and stability. Thanks to the group and their own efforts they are becoming healthier.
